Maori Girl’s Fate

A young Maori girl was drowned, ih the Waahi stream, Iluntly. Wounds on the face suggested that the child in falling had struck the plank used by the Maoris in the locality to cross the stream. The victim was Parelia Punekai, aged three, daughter of Mrs. Riha Punekai, of Waahi Pa. " --
